Description

from St. Augustine Ghosts & Gravestones Trolley of the Doomed
Hop aboard Old Town Trolley's Trolley of the Doomed and prepare yourself as your talented Ghost Host shares tales of misfortune and mayhem. Aboard this Ghosts and Gravestones St Augustine tour, you'll hear accounts of long-gone residents still seen in numerous locations throughout the city. The tumultuous past transcends into the present as the trolley journeys through this historic city.

Pass by some of the scariest and most sacred sites, including the Huguenot Cemetery, the final resting place of the victims of yellow fever... or was it final? Some visitors to the burial grounds have reported seeing eerie apparitions and translucent orbs floating about.

If you keep a watchful eye while passing the City Gates, you might catch a glimpse of Elizabeth, a child victim of yellow fever, waving to passersby.

You will also pass the Tolomato Cemetery. Who’s playing games in the cemetery when the sun goes down? Is it the spirit of five-year-old James jumping from branch to branch in the trees, or is it the Ghost Bride, still waiting for her walk down the aisle?

Hear About the Old Drug Store and Enter Potter's Wax Museum
Built on the edge of the Tolomato Cemetery sits one of St. Augustine’s most recognizable buildings, the Old Drug Store. Unexplained noises, cold spots and shadows reportedly moving on their own makeup only a few of the hundreds of documented supernatural occurrences. Learn the secrets to these hauntings that have plagued the Old Drug Store from the time it first opened in 1887. Afterward, get an exclusive nighttime experience inside Potter’s Wax Museum’s Chamber of Horrors for a unique retelling of the famed pirate Andrew Ranson’s gruesome execution.

Visit the Old Jail, One of the City's Most Haunted Places
You will end your journey with a visit to the Old Jail, one of the city’s most haunted locations. Listed on the Florida and National registry of Haunted Places, the Old Jail has been the site of countless supernatural occurrences. Many criminals have met their maker here. A shiv in the back or a hangman’s noose ended numerous lives. Be on the lookout for former prisoner Charlie Powell, as he is just as mischievous dead as he was alive. Visitors to the Old Jail have experienced cold spots, strange odors, loud banging noises, orbs of light, and even apparitions.

Frequently Asked Questions about St. Augustine Ghosts & Gravestones Trolley of the Doomed

Where is it located?

The Ghosts and Gravestones frightseeing tour boards at the Welcome Center located at 27 San Marco Ave., St. Augustine, Florida.

Is the tour appropriate for children?

This haunted tour is rated PG-13 and is not intended for young children. It is a historical tour turned completely on its head and uses haunted-house style moments, historical facts, and creative storytelling to thrill, entertain, and scare guests.

Is the tour wheelchair accessible?

Unfortunately, this tour is not wheelchair accessible.

How long is the tour?

Tour duration is approximately 60 minutes.

Can I bring my camera?

Absolutely! Be sure to ask your driver for tips to increase your chances of photographing the supernatural.

What happens if it rains?

While every attempt will be made to conduct the tour, it may be cancelled if weather conditions become too severe. Cancelled tours may be rescheduled or refunded.

How much walking is there?

Comfortable shoes are recommended as there is considerable walking to and from the trolley and the Old Jail. Inside, you will encounter stairs and narrow hallways.

Are the ghost stories true or make believe?

The stories are based on local legend and lore and have been historically researched. The stories weave together the history and haunted tales associated with the sites.
